Qualcomm and Meta sign agreement to jointly produce custom chips for VR devices

According to the latest report, Facebook parent company Meta and Qualcomm announced today at the “Berlin Consumer Electronics Show” that the two sides have signed an agreement, by Qualcomm for Meta’s Quest virtual reality (VR) ) equipment to produce custom chipsets.

Meta and Qualcomm said in a statement that the companies’ engineering and product teams will work together to produce the chips. The chips will be powered by Qualcomm’s “Snapdragon” platform.

The companies did not disclose the financial details of the deal. But the collaboration demonstrates Meta’s recognition and continued support of Qualcomm’s technology, even as Meta is trying to develop its own custom chips for its planned line of virtual, augmented, and mixed reality devices.

In this regard, Meta spokesman Tyler Yee said that although the chipset produced through this partnership is not unique to Meta, it is specifically optimized for the Quest’s system specifications. The partnership agreement only covers virtual reality devices, and Meta will continue to work on developing some of its own new silicon solutions, Yi said.

“In some cases, we use off-the-shelf chips, or work with industry partners to customize them, but at the same time, we’re exploring new chip solutions of our own. So there’s a possibility that it could be in the same product,” said Taylor Yi. A case of using both partners and custom solutions. It’s all about creating the best ‘metaverse’ experience possible.”

For years, Meta has relied on Qualcomm chips for its virtual reality devices, including its latest Quest 2 headset. According to research firm IDC, the Quest 2 holds about 90 percent of the virtual reality hardware market. In addition, Meta has invested heavily in technologies such as full-color pass-through and augmented reality glasses in an attempt to bring CEO Mark Zuckerberg’s vision of a “metaverse” to life.
